The Tyne and Wear Metro is starring in its own TV advert as the service looks to build on growing passenger numbers.

An all-star cast of popular local visitor attractions feature in the advert, part of a new campaign to inspire summer days out travelling by Metro. The advert hit television screens today, Monday 6 July.

DB Regio and Nexus have opted for a TV marketing campaign to build on Metro’s recent passenger growth, which is now the fastest outside of London.

‘Good to Know’ is Metro’s first television advert in more than ten years, and features a variety of destinations around the network, including Bill Quay Community Farm in Gateshead, Ocean Beach Pleasure Park in South Shields, Mowbray Park in Sunderland, Kind Edward’s Bay in Tynemouth and Central Arcade in Newcastle.

The advert will run throughout the summer on 14 Sky channels, including Sky1, Sky Sports and Sky Movies, Monument Movies and will also be available to watch on Tyne and Wear Metro’s social media channels including Facebook, Twitter and You Tube.

It brings to life the iconic Metro logo as you’ve never seen it before and follows couples, friends and families enjoying memorable moments at locations within easy reach of a Metro station.

Emma Brough, Customer Service Director at DB Regio Tyne and Wear, which operates the Metro on behalf of Nexus, said: “Metro has the fastest growing passenger numbers outside of London and we are looking to build on that.

“We’re encouraging our customers to make a day of it this summer by exploring as many of the fantastic places to go and visit located next to a Metro station.

“We’re extremely lucky to have such a diverse range of things to do across the region and our new advert captures the many unique experiences which can be enjoyed, from building sandcastles at the beach to enjoying a movie and a bite to eat in the city.

“With 60 stations around Tyne and Wear and frequent trains, Metro is the hassle-free way to travel. Plus children under five travel for free. So whether you’re planning a day out by the seaside or want to explore history at a local museum, we’ll help you squeeze as much fun out of the school holidays as possible.”

Metro will be teaming-up with a host of popular attractions around the region to provide an exclusive range of special offers and discounts for its passengers this summer.

Not only that, visitors to partner attractions will have the chance to meet the newest member of the Metro team. As seen in the new advert, Metro’s friendly character will be meeting families and handing out free activity packs and spot prizes at the following locations during the holidays:
 

• Great North Museum: Hancock – July 18 to July 20 July (11am to 3pm)
• Blue Reef Aquarium – July 24 to July 26 (11am to 3pm)
• Ocean Beach Pleasure Park – July 31 to August 2(11am to 3pm)
• Seven Stories, the National Centre for Books – August 8 (11am to 3pm) and August 9 (10am to 1pm)
• National Glass Centre – August 13 to August 15 (11am to 3pm)
• Life Science Centre – August 21 to August 23 (11am to 3pm)
• Bill Quay Community Farm – August 28 to August 30 (11am to 3pm)
